The Certificate in Integrated Aquaculture Systems program prepares students for diverse roles in the growing aquaculture industry in the UK. This 3D pie chart illustrates the distribution of job opportunities and corresponding salary ranges for various positions related to this certificate. 1. **Fish Health Specialist**: These professionals focus on maintaining the health and well-being of aquatic species, ensuring sustainable practices, and driving innovation in the field. With a strong background in biology and aquaculture, Fish Health Specialists can earn between ยฃ24,000 and ยฃ40,000 per year in the UK. 2. **Aquaponics Engineer**: Combining aquaculture and hydroponics, Aquaponics Engineers design and maintain recirculating systems for both fish and plants, managing water quality, and optimizing production efficiency. These experts can earn between ยฃ28,000 and ยฃ50,000 annually in the UK. 3. **Recirculation Systems Technician**: These professionals install, repair, and maintain recirculation systems in aquaculture facilities, ensuring smooth operations and high-quality production. Recirculation Systems Technicians can expect salaries between ยฃ20,000 and ยฃ35,000 in the UK. 4. **Aquaculture Operations Manager**: Overseeing daily operations of aquaculture facilities, these managers coordinate staff, manage budgets, and develop strategies for growth and improvement. Aquaculture Operations Managers typically earn between ยฃ30,000 and ยฃ60,000 in the UK. 5. **Hatchery Manager**: Responsible for the incubation and early growth of fish, Hatchery Managers manage staff, maintain facility infrastructure, and ensure the health and welfare of fish populations. Hatchery Managers in the UK earn between ยฃ25,000 and ยฃ45,000 per year. These roles and salary ranges demonstrate the growing demand for skilled professionals in the Integrated Aquaculture Systems field in the UK.
